> > I stopped bacula-fd and delete .state files on all clients.
> > When I run backups the monthly label start at 01, it is Monthly-01, while
> > Daily starts at 02, Daily-02.
> > My question is: why Daily starts at 02 and not 01 even if I delete all
> > .state files in all clients?
> > Thank you.
>
>
> I think bacula uses a single counter for all auto-labelled volumes.
No. You can configure a Counter Resource, i.e.
http://wiki.bacula.org/doku.php?id=bacula_manual:the_counter_resource
If
> you want to create a certain sequence, I guess you'd have to label the
> volumes manually.
>
No, as above.
